【摘要】:目前,延長石油集團(tuán)已經(jīng)開展的勘探開發(fā)涉及的范圍廣、地域跨度大,在2007年已經(jīng)成功跨入國家千萬噸級大油氣田行列。但是經(jīng)過100多年的勘探開發(fā),勘探開發(fā)地質(zhì)對象日趨復(fù)雜,勘探開發(fā)難度不斷加大,資源結(jié)構(gòu)、產(chǎn)量結(jié)構(gòu)和投入產(chǎn)出等矛盾日益突出。從世界石油天然氣勘探開發(fā)技術(shù)進(jìn)步來看,要破解這些難題,必須依賴于信息技術(shù),信息技術(shù)已成為推動石油工業(yè)飛速發(fā)展的重要的內(nèi)在動力。為此,本文重點研究了勘探開發(fā)信息化平臺建設(shè),建立科學(xué)、有效的綜合管理信息平臺,對提高勘探生產(chǎn)和運行效率具有重要意義。 本文以延長油氣田勘探開發(fā)業(yè)務(wù)為研究對象,,結(jié)合延長石油集團(tuán)勘探開發(fā)業(yè)務(wù)的發(fā)展現(xiàn)狀,以SOA理念為核心,兼顧未來“云計算”發(fā)展模式,確定系統(tǒng)總體建設(shè)架構(gòu),依據(jù)具體建設(shè)架構(gòu)對勘探開發(fā)信息化系統(tǒng)建設(shè)進(jìn)行基本規(guī)劃,將信息化建設(shè)劃分為十二個工程項目,用來指導(dǎo)信息化持續(xù)建設(shè)的業(yè)務(wù)方向。分析研究十二個工程項目的建設(shè),明確提出各工程項目的建設(shè)目標(biāo)及內(nèi)容,并對各子項目的實施進(jìn)行詳細(xì)設(shè)計。最后分析、評估了實施勘探開發(fā)信息化建設(shè)中可能存在的風(fēng)險和預(yù)期的應(yīng)用效益,以便使實施過程中能夠提前采取正確的應(yīng)對和防范措施,從而規(guī)避風(fēng)險;同時評估預(yù)期應(yīng)用效果,使信息化建設(shè)方案滾動完善,持續(xù)優(yōu)化提升,能夠更符合實際情況和發(fā)展要求。 實際投入應(yīng)用,應(yīng)用效果良好,勘探開發(fā)信息化建設(shè)能夠安全、高效地管理延長油田的所有勘探開發(fā)數(shù)據(jù)資源,實現(xiàn)數(shù)據(jù)共享,使數(shù)據(jù)資源的使用價值大大提高;同時能夠建立可以適應(yīng)各級業(yè)務(wù)管理的應(yīng)用系統(tǒng),從而有效支撐業(yè)務(wù)的精細(xì)化管理和優(yōu)化運行。
[Abstract]:At present, Yanchang Petroleum Group has carried out a wide range of exploration and development, the region span is large, in 2007 has successfully entered the country's million tons of large oil and gas fields.But after more than 100 years of exploration and development, the geological objects of exploration and development are becoming more and more complex, the difficulty of exploration and development is increasing, and the contradictions of resource structure, output structure and input and output are becoming increasingly prominent.In view of the progress of oil and gas exploration and development technology in the world, to solve these problems, we must rely on information technology, which has become an important internal power to promote the rapid development of petroleum industry.Therefore, this paper focuses on the construction of information platform for exploration and development and the establishment of a scientific and effective comprehensive management information platform, which is of great significance for improving the efficiency of exploration and production.This paper takes Yanchang oil and gas field exploration and development business as the research object, combined with the present situation of Yanchang oil group's exploration and development business, taking the SOA concept as the core, taking into account the future "cloud computing" development model, and determining the overall construction framework of the system.According to the concrete construction framework, this paper plans the construction of the information system of exploration and development, and divides the information construction into 12 projects, which can be used to guide the business direction of the information sustainable construction.This paper analyzes and studies the construction of 12 engineering projects, puts forward the construction objectives and contents of each project, and designs the implementation of each sub-project in detail.Finally, the paper evaluates the possible risks and expected application benefits in the implementation of exploration and development information construction, so that the correct countermeasures and preventive measures can be taken in the process of implementation in order to avoid the risks.At the same time, the expected application effect can be evaluated, so that the information construction scheme can be improved and continuously optimized, which can meet the actual situation and development requirements.The information construction of exploration and development can safely and efficiently manage all exploration and development data resources in Yanchang Oilfield, realize data sharing, and greatly improve the use value of data resources.At the same time, it can set up the application system which can adapt to all levels of business management, so as to effectively support the fine management and optimal operation of the business.
